Transaction 643bbfa9fd5a2c863ecce74682e38cd3784202fdee1b47bdc66a1c64c3d2740c
1 Input
1 Outputs
- 643bbfa9fd5a2c863ecce74682e38cd3784202fdee1b47bdc66a1c64c3d2740c:0
value 121503654
address 384AThJwoQbmPee73GzY1tLvXtUCCRRa1H